Breed-Specific Details
Falkland
Smooth and soft with an easy, even draft. Produces a round, balanced yarn with excellent versatility. Well-suited for consistent singles and multi-ply yarns.
Merino
Exceptionally soft with a fine, dense crimp. Drafts smoothly and spins into soft, elastic yarn with beautiful drape. Ideal for next-to-skin projects and spinners who love a plush hand feel.
Rambouillet
Springy and elastic with a denser feel. Drafts best with a controlled hand and produces lofty yarn with strong memory. Ideal for socks, hats, and textured stitches that benefit from bounce.
Romney
Sturdy and durable with a longer staple length. Drafts smoothly and spins into a strong, textured yarn. Excellent for weaving, outerwear, felting, and projects where structure and durability matter.
Targhee
Soft, bouncy, and forgiving to spin. Creates plush, lofty yarn with warmth and elasticity. A great choice for cozy garments and next-to-skin wearables.
